<title>lib/bitmap: drop optimization of bitmap_{from,to}_arr64</title>

bitmap_{from,to}_arr64() optimization is overly optimistic on 32-bit LE
architectures when it's wired to bitmap_copy_clear_tail().

bitmap_copy_clear_tail() takes care of unused bits in the bitmap up to
the next word boundary. But on 32-bit machines when copying bits from
bitmap to array of 64-bit words, it's expected that the unused part of
a recipient array must be cleared up to 64-bit boundary, so the last 4
bytes may stay untouched when nbits % 64 &lt;= 32.

While the copying part of the optimization works correct, that clear-tail
trick makes corresponding tests reasonably fail:

test_bitmap: bitmap_to_arr64(nbits == 1): tail is not safely cleared: 0xa5a5a5a500000001 (must be 0x0000000000000001)

Fix it by removing bitmap_{from,to}_arr64() optimization for 32-bit LE
arches.

<title>lib/bitmap: add bitmap_weight_and()</title>

The function calculates Hamming weight of (bitmap1 &amp; bitmap2). Now we
have to do like this:
	tmp = bitmap_alloc(nbits);
	bitmap_and(tmp, map1, map2, nbits);
	weight = bitmap_weight(tmp, nbits);
	bitmap_free(tmp);

This requires additional memory, adds pressure on alloc subsystem, and
way less cache-friendly than just:
	weight = bitmap_weight_and(map1, map2, nbits);

The following patches apply it for cpumask functions.

<title>lib/bitmap: fix off-by-one in bitmap_to_arr64()</title>

GENMASK*() family takes the first and the last bits of the mask
*including* them. So, with the current code bitmap_to_arr64()
doesn't clear the tail properly:

nbits %  exp             mask                must be
1        GENMASK(1, 0)   0x3                 0x1
...
63       GENMASK(63, 0)  0xffffffffffffffff  0x7fffffffffffffff

This was found by making the function always available instead of
32-bit BE systems only (for reusing in some new functionality).
Turn the number of bits into the last bit set by subtracting 1.
@nbits is already checked to be positive beforehand.

<title>bitmap: Fix return values to be unsigned</title>

Both nodemask and bitmap routines had mixed return values that provided
potentially signed return values that could never happen. This was
leading to the compiler getting confusing about the range of possible
return values (it was thinking things could be negative where they could
not be). In preparation for fixing nodemask, fix all the bitmap routines
that should be returning unsigned (or bool) values.

<title>lib: add bitmap_{from,to}_arr64</title>

Manipulating 64-bit arrays with bitmap functions is potentially dangerous
because on 32-bit BE machines the order of halfwords doesn't match.
Another issue is that compiler may throw a warning about out-of-boundary
access.

This patch adds bitmap_{from,to}_arr64 functions in addition to existing
bitmap_{from,to}_arr32.
